The announcement comes as the 2025 WebAIM Million study reveals that 94.8% of the top one million websites contain accessibility barriers, with educational institutions particularly affected by communication challenges that traditional websites fail to address. Research Validates Website Communication Crisis According to the WebAIM Million 2025 report, which analyzed the top 1,000,000 websites globally, 94.8% of home pages had detected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) failures. The study found 50,960,288 distinct accessibility errors across the analyzed websites, averaging 51 errors per page. 'The data clearly shows that traditional websites systematically fail users,' said Aftab Jiwani, Founder of GPT AI Corporation, Inc. 'When 94.8% of websites contain accessibility barriers and users encounter errors on 1 in every 24 website elements, it's evident that websites are a thing of the past.' The WebAIM research indicates that users with disabilities encounter accessibility errors on 4.1% of all home page elements, creating significant barriers to information access. The most common failures include low contrast text affecting 79.1% of pages, missing alternative text for images on 55.5% of pages, and missing form input labels on 48.2% of pages. PRNewswire Dublin [Ireland], July 23: BrowserStack, the world's leading software testing platform, today announced the launch of its Accessibility Design Toolkit, a Figma plugin that helps design teams build accessible products right from the design stage. Figma plugin powered by BrowserStack's proprietary Spectra™ Rule Engine, prevents up to 40% of accessibility issues before development even begins. BrowserStack's collaboration with WebAIM on the 2025 WebAIM Million report reveals the scope of the problem: 94.8% of one million analyzed homepages had at least one WCAG failure, with color contrast and missing alt text issues ranking among the top two--both preventable during design. The findings underscore the urgency to start designing with accessibility in mind. With over 8,800 ADA lawsuits filed in 2024 and the European Accessibility Act now in effect, teams are under growing pressure to meet accessibility standards, yet most still address these issues after launch, when fixes become harder and more expensive. "Teams have lacked the tools to catch accessibility issues early, even though most originate in the design phase," said Nakul Aggarwal, Co-founder and CTO at BrowserStack. "Our toolkit addresses this by empowering designers to resolve up to 40% of these issues directly within Figma." Powered by BrowserStack's proprietary Spectra™ Rule Engine, the Accessibility Design Toolkit helps shift accessibility left and enables design teams to: * Instantly scan Figma design files for color contrast, touch target size, spacing issues, and more * Auto-detect UI components, validate against WCAG standards, and auto-annotate with ARIA roles * Get AI-powered suggestions to add alt text, fix heading structure, and improve keyboard focus order * Generate developer-ready handoffs with built-in accessibility specs and clear annotations The Accessibility Design Toolkit is a part of BrowserStack's all-in-one accessibility suite and is now available to all Figma users, integrating seamlessly into existing workflows. The internet wasn't built with accessibility (i.e., everyone) in mind. In its early days, it was chaotic—blinking text, auto-playing music, and little navigation. While web design and user experiences have evolved, accessibility remains an afterthought for many businesses. Even today, millions of people encounter daily barriers online: a checkout button they can't reach, a form they can't complete, a video they can't hear. Beyond creating usable experiences for all users, digital accessibility is also a legal requirement. Regulations like the Americans with Disabilities Act, or ADA, and the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ines, or WCAG, set clear compliance standards, yet many organizations struggle to keep up. With websites constantly evolving, accessibility can't be a one-time fix—it requires ongoing monitoring, fixes, expertise, and an approach that scales, AudioEye reports. Despite growing awareness and legal requirements, the internet remains frustratingly out of reach for millions of users. Nearly 96% of the top one million homepages analyzed in the 2024 WebAIM Million report contained detectable accessibility issues. That means broken experiences, inaccessible content, and everyday frustrations for people who rely on assistive technology to browse, shop, and interact online. For businesses, the challenge isn't just about fixing what's broken—it's about keeping up. Websites are living, evolving systems, constantly updated with new content, design elements, and features. Without a structured approach to accessibility, even well-intentioned efforts can fall short, leaving gaps that impact usability and compliance. Ensuring digital accessibility involves more than just checking a box for compliance. It requires addressing a range of common yet critical issues that hinder usability. AudioEye's 2025 Digital Accessibility Index, a comprehensive analysis of digital accessibility compliance of 15,000 websites, found an average of 297 accessibility issues per page. Most of these issues can be tied to one of the following: Non-descriptive links – Over 80% of websites contain vague or ambiguous links, making navigation difficult for screen reader users. Missing alt text – 38% of images lack appropriate alt descriptions, preventing users with visual impairments from understanding essential content. Form labeling issues – 35% of pages contain forms lacking clear labels or instructions, making navigation difficult for users who depend on assistive technology to interact with essential site functions. To address these challenges effectively, businesses need a scalable, proactive, and multi-layered approach—one that combines automation, human expertise, and continuous monitoring. The only way to achieve lasting accessibility is to use a multi-layered approach that blends AI-driven automation, human expertise, and proactive testing. This gold standard ensures businesses don't just fix issues today—but build accessibility into their long-term digital strategy. 1. Automation technology AI-powered automation serves as a critical first step, scanning websites to detect common accessibility barriers and applying real-time fixes for issues like missing alt text, poor color contrast, and ambiguous link descriptions. This technology helps businesses quickly address widespread accessibility challenges, improving usability at scale. However, automation alone isn't enough. Research shows that automated tools can only detect about 30-60% of WCAG issues, and even the best tools can only automatically fix about half of those issues. That's why a truly effective accessibility strategy integrates both AI-driven efficiency and human expertise. 2. Human expertise to catch what AI misses Some accessibility issues require a nuanced understanding of accessibility professionals and individuals who rely on assistive technology daily. Expert fixes help identify areas that automation alone might miss, such as contextual errors in navigation, form usability, or assistive technology compatibility. By combining automation with human expertise, organizations can efficiently address high-impact accessibility challenges, improve compliance, and create more accessible digital experiences. 3. Continuous monitoring and testing during development For developers who prefer to own their digital accessibility programs from the start, integrating accessibility checks directly into the design and development workflow utilizing accessibility testing tools can help them find and fix issues before they hit live environments. In doing so, organizations can reduce long-term compliance risks, avoid costly retroactive fixes, and improve overall site performance.
